Investigators (Dana and Charlie) met Mary Jo and her family at their residence on 9-10-13. A lighting storm lingered dangerously close so we had to take measurements quickly. Its height was estimated at about 7 and half feet tall and it stood approximately 150 feet from Mary Jo.

Mary Jo and a friend were skipping rocks in her backyard pond when Mary Jo went to look for more rocks. She remembers hearing a grunting sound. “It sounded like a hog,” she explained. When she looked in the direction of the grunts, the grunting stopped. She observed a big, blackish/brown figure standing on two legs in the treeline. The features which were most memorable to Mary Jo: The arms hung straight down to its knees, the head was pointed towards the top, no noticeable ears, a wide/flat nose with noticeable nostrils, and its shoulders were very wide like a football player. We asked Mary Jo if she could recall other details, but that’s all she could remember. The creature never moved. Immediately upon seeing the creature, Mary Jo grabbed her friend and fled inside the house.

Important Notes: On a few different occasions Mary Jo’s father heard very loud tree knocks while hunting in his tree stand on this same property and one evening while standing on his front porch; fresh water mussels are frequently found opened around the pond (although this could be the result of a raccoon); and surprisingly, a confirmed bear track was verified on the property the same year. Based on the track, Fish and Game estimated the bear between 400-500lbs. Coincidently on a separate occasion, Mary Jo did see the bear on the opposite side of the pond on all fours. Mary Jo is familiar with what a bear looks like and due to the creature’s broad shoulders noticed the day she was skipping rocks, this seems more likely to be a bigfoot. Not to mention, the creature was observing the two girls from a tree line standing on two legs and this area has an extensive history of bigfoot sightings which are not published due to confidentiality, including law enforcement and two park rangers.

Coon hunters Ron and Jason were driving down Hwy 245 when they saw an upright, dark, huge creature run across the road. Both men stressed, "It was very fast!" The creature ran across the edge of the outstretched beam of the truck's headlights, therefore the witnesses mostly noticed its legs. It was said to be very dark in color (maybe black), hairy and "it was definitely running on two legs." Ron and Jason are very experienced hunters and they reassured me, " this was not a bear or deer." I asked if it was uniform in color, or if you could see what appeared to be shoes? They both agreed they did not notice shoes and it was dark and hairy all over. Jason asked Ron, "what was that? and Ron replied, "I don't know, what was that?" They estimated it around 8 foot or maybe taller.

Follow Up: 9-6-2013

About a year ago we (the KBRO) were on an investigation late one evening and came across two coon hunters on a dark, desolate road. They asked what we were doing, and after explaining our intentions, we fully anticipated a chuckle, instead they paused for a moment, then told us about a sighting they had the prior year!

Jason and Ron observed a huge, bi-pedal figure cross the road in front of their truck. It was just beyond their headlights, yet close enough to tell it was massive, running quickly on two legs, dark in color (black or really dark brown) and at least 8 foot or taller. It happened so fast that it was difficult to obtain much detail, however Jason reiterated a few times that it was definitely NOT a person. It never looked in their direction. It ran at a slight angle away from the truck. This stretch of road is paralleled by dense woods on both sides. When they slowed the truck down to see where it went, it had already disappeared into the thick cedar trees. As most typical road crossings, this sighting took place immediately after their vehicle rounded a curve.

We had to pursue Jason, thus it was very nice of him to take time out of his busy schedule to meet us. His story was 100% consistent to the story we heard from both men during our first meeting--never wavering nor adding any embellishment. I found him highly credible. My mom and I were sitting at the pink liquor store at the bottom of Martin Hill almost to Dixie Hwy. As a matter of fact only feet from Dixie. We saw two dogs running loose and watched them investigate a wooded area and suddenly a tall black creature walked across a field. I've never seen a black bear over 7ft.tall. No man I've ever met is 7ft tall or taller. When this creature walked it's arms swayed side to side. The dogs would not go back the same way they came, and acted weird until the creature turned and went in the woods.

Describe the creature with detail: 7ft tall, long arms, black fur

Follow Up 11-3-11:

I spoke to both witnesses by phone. The reason they were parked at that location was to pick up some important papers from her son/brother on his way to work and it was a convenient meeting spot. They first noticed the dogs as they emerged from the woods, one with its tail between its legs. The dogs walked and did not run. No barking or whimpering was noticed. At this moment they watched an 8 foot tall hairy creature walk across the field. It had long black hair and swung its long arms dramatically as it walked. “It walked straight up, not hunched over”. It was too far away to see its face, hands or feet. The head was large and round, not conical. It had “very wide shoulders.” It appeared as if it had just crossed Dixie Hwy near a flood wall. It walked swiftly across the field and into the woods. Both witnesses seemed very sincere and credible.

Called witness and spoke with him at great length. He was deer hunting from a stand around 9:00am. Usually every morning he sees deer around this time, however on this occasion it was eerily quiet. He often takes pictures with his phone and sends them to his buddies. He decided to take a picture of himself. After viewing the picture, he noticed a dark figure about 70yds away in the background. He slowly turned his head around to catch a glimpse of a 6-7ft tall, hairy creature standing on two legs. To gain a better view, the witness reached for his gun to view the creature from his scope, but by the time he turned back around the creature was gone. The sighting lasted only 7-10 seconds. He did see it move it's head a little, almost like it was looking around. The witness got the impression the animal was lost. Do to the great distance and short time, little detail could be deciphered regarding it's face or other details. It was definitely on two legs. It was "very" hairy --dark brown, almost black. It had wide shoulders. After about 10 minutes, the witness cautiously climbed down from his stand and ran back to his truck. He did return only once to retrieve his deer stand and has never gone back since. He stated, "It was not like anything I have ever seen before. Every day since this has happened, I think about it. I have never told anyone and want to remain anonymous. I have goose bumps now just telling you the story.
